Forex kitty surges for fourth week as RBI adds $6.6 billion

THE foreign exchange reserves continue to gain, adding $6.596 billion to a five-month high of $665.4 billion in the week to March 28, according to the latest data from the central bank.
In the previous three weeks, the RBI cumulatively added $20.1 billion. According to the government, this can cover 11 months of imports and makes the country's reserves the fourth largest in the world after China, which has over $3.3 trillion in its reserves, followed by Japan with $1.23 trillion, and the tiny Switzerland at the third place with $927 billion, which is 1.5 times of our forex reserve.
The reserves rose $6.56 billion to $665.4 billion as of March 28, the Reserve Bank said on Friday. This marks the highest level in nearly five months.
